Visiting Artist Roberto Lugo featured on PBS

Ceramicist Roberto Lugo was recently on PBS’s Articulate program. Lugo attend the 2016 Ceramics Symposium at the Lawrence Arts Center as a visiting artist and inspired attendees with his pottery demonstrations and popular art talk.

PBS’s video segment “The Ghetto Potter,” which is also Roberto Lugo’s self-proclaimed nickname, explores the ways in which his art is the product of a convergence between classical forms and the influences of his North Philadelphia neighborhood. Learn about how graffiti, postmodernism, spoken word poetry, and racial activism all play a part in his Lugo’s artistic process in this short video.
